Mauricio Pochettino stays open to returning to Tottenham after the World Cup even when Spurs are relegated to the Championship, in keeping with new experiences. The Premier League massive six membership are looking out for a brand new everlasting supervisor in the summertime. Thomas Frank was sacked final month after eight months in cost, paying the worth for a run of two wins in 17 Premier League matches. Igor Tudor has since been put in because the membership’s interim supervisor till the tip of the season.
The Italian’s two matches thus far have each led to defeat, a 4-1 loss to Arsenal adopted by a 2-1 reverse at Fulham. Tudor stated afterwards: “I need to see the whole lot extra, the whole lot extra. We’re lack after we assault, we’re missing of the standard to attain the aim, we’re missing within the center to run and we’re missing behind to remain there to undergo and never concede the aim. In fact it is a confidence downside.”
Again-to-back defeats below Tudor leaves Tottenham sixteenth and 4 factors above the relegation zone going into Thursday’s recreation at residence to Crystal Palace. West Ham and Nottingham Forest each play earlier than then and might slim the hole.
However the north Londoners have acquired some optimistic information, in keeping with experiences. That is as a result of the much-loved Pochettino is open to heading again to Tottenham even when they drop all the way down to the second tier, per GiveMeSport’s Ben Jacobs.
The problem is that Spurs would nonetheless must discover a strategy to adequately pay the Argentine, who earns round £4.6million a 12 months as the pinnacle coach of america nationwide workforce. That equates to round £90,000 every week.
He was on £8.5m per 12 months – roughly £160,000 every week – in his earlier stint at Spurs. The 54-year-old constructed a title-challenging workforce in his spell between 2014 and 2019, though he didn’t ship silverware.
Regardless of that, Pochettino’s youthful attacking workforce was among the best Spurs sides ever and he gained 160 of his 293 video games in cost for a win ratio of 54 per cent. Of the 5 everlasting managers since Pochettino was sacked seven years in the past, none have bettered that.
